1871008464London: John Murray 1871. First edition first printing. Hardcover. This is the first edition first impression of Charles Darwins The Descent of Man and Selection in Relation to Sex in the publishers original green cloth bindings. Herein on page 2 of Volume I is his first use of the term evolution. <br /> <br />First impression of the first edition is confirmed by issue points; in Volume I transmitted is the first word on p.297; Volume II has errata on the title page verso seventeen errata for Volume I and eight for Volume II and a tipped-in Postscript at unpaginated pp. ix-x referring to errors which were reset for the second issue. The sixteen pages of advertisements for Mr. Murrays List of Popular Works are present in each volume following the text following the lengthy Index in Volume II. The sole previous ownership name is an armorial bookplate affixed to the Volume I front pastedown. <br /> <br />On the Origin of Species 1859 fomented a reorientation that would eventually supplant dogmatic creationist hierarchy with rationalistic naturalist biology. But in Origin Darwin had said little about how his ideas applied to human beings. In The Descent of Man and Selection in Relation to Sex Darwin argued that all creatures are subject to the same natural laws. Man still bears in his bodily frame the indelible stamp of his lowly origin. And in Descent the cause was finally given its enduring name. On page two of Volume I Darwin wrote these great classes of facts afford as it appears to me ample and conclusive evidence in favour of the principle of gradual evolution. This is the first time the word evolution is thus applied in his published work. Descent posited the theory Darwin called sexual selection and attempted to set forth a naturalistic explanation for the mind and for moral behavior. That Darwins conceptions continue to fuel both rational debate and fervid ire testifies to their fundamental impact.
